| Parking/Access Road Notes: |
Plenty for the Mt. Pemi Trail is at the Flume Visitors Center. Walk up the bike path 150' and turn left to pass under the highway. We left a second car at the Indian Head Motel as that trailhead was not plowed. |

| Comments: |
We used snowshoes, but the trail is passable in light traction.
Ascended via Mt. Pemi Tr.; descended via Indian Head Tr.
Also, at 2345', we bushwhacked south .15 mi. to a view ledge referenced by 1HappyHiker and Steve Smith. It was a nice add on to an easy hike. |
